AnyDVD 6.4.0.0 BD+ Decryption

Slysoft has just released their V6.4.0.0 with BD+ decryption. What do you think . Post your successes or failures.
nyDVD History

6.4.0.0 2008 03 19
- New (Blu-ray): Removes the BD+ protection from Blu-ray discs!
(for increased compatibility with titles released by Twentieth
Century Fox :-) )
- New (Blu-ray): Added option to enable / disable BD+ removal
- New (DVD): AnyDVD ripper no longer uses the Windows filesystem, it
has now its own UDF parser / reader.
Discs which cannot be read by Windows can now be copied with the
AnyDVD ripper.
- Fix (Blu-ray): Black display with some BD discs, e.g., "Layer Cake",
second release, "The Fugitive", "Wild Things" (all Region B)
- Fix (DVD): Small bugfix in "repairing defective disc structure"
function of AnyDVD ripper
- Fix (DVD): Problems with some Arccos protected titles, e.g.
"The Grudge", R1, US
- Some minor fixes and improvements
- Updated languages

Hey, Zevia, this is what we were waiting for. Process away! For those that simply want to rip their movies to watch on an HTPC (some without HDCP) this is also what you've been waiting for. Now you an rip to an ISO, mount it with Daemon Tools, and play it back with whatever software you want. I'm watching Simpsons from an image right now with PowerDVD 3370. EXCELLENT!!
